Electrostatic painting services involve a specialized coating process that uses electrical charges to apply paint or finishes evenly across surfaces. This technique ensures a smooth, consistent layer of paint, reducing overspray and waste. It is particularly effective for achieving a professional-looking finish on various surfaces, including walls, ceilings, cabinets, and other fixtures. The process is often quicker and more efficient than traditional painting methods, making it a popular choice for both interior and exterior projects.

This service is especially helpful for solving problems related to uneven paint coverage, drips, and paint wastage. What surfaces can electrostatic painting be applied to? Electrostatic painting is suitable for a variety of surfaces, including metal, wood, and plastic, making it versatile for different projects.

How does electrostatic painting differ from traditional painting? Electrostatic painting uses an electric charge to attract paint to surfaces, resulting in a smooth, even finish with minimal overspray compared to conventional methods.

Are electrostatic painting services suitable for both indoor and outdoor applications? Yes, local service providers can perform electrostatic painting on both indoor and outdoor surfaces, depending on the project requirements.

What types of finishes can be achieved with electrostatic painting? Electrostatic painting can produce a variety of finishes, including matte, gloss, and semi-gloss, to match different aesthetic preferences.

Is electrostatic painting appropriate for large-scale or small-scale projects? Electrostatic painting is effective for projects of all sizes, from small repairs to large commercial or industrial applications.
